Dual RNA Sequencing Analysis of Bacillus amyloliquefaciens and Sclerotinia sclerotiorum During Infection of Soybean Seedlings by S. sclerotiorum Unveils Antagonistic Interactions
Soybean Sclerotinia stem rot is caused by Sclerotinia sclerotiorum infection, which causes extensive and severe damage to soybean production.
